The Power of Similarities in Relationships


We often hear that opposites attract - but in real life, it's our similarities that build lasting bonds. Here's why that matters.

“If you would win a man to your cause, first convince him that you are his sincere friend.” - Abraham Lincoln

 

Why We Connect Through Common Ground

Strong relationships - whether personal or professional - are built on shared:

  • Experiences
  • Backgrounds
  • Values

When we feel understood, we feel safe. And when we feel safe, trust grows.

A touch of difference can add excitement, but too much contrast without connection leads to friction.

 

Love and Loss: What We Focus on Matters

  • In love, we often see only the similarities and overlook the differences.
  • In conflict, especially during separation, we focus on the differences and forget what we once shared.

This shift in focus can make or break a relationship.

 

Where’s Your Focus?

If you're noticing tension with a colleague, partner, or friend, ask yourself:

Am I focusing on what divides us - or what connects us?

When we choose to see the common ground, we create smoother, more resilient relationships.
